I have replaced the radiator. Brand new just bought a few weeks ago radiator. I was in a wreck and had most parts replaced to new, but when i first drove her she overheated on me in a matter of seconds! Pulled back into the driveway and it spewed out from the front like a water hose spitting at you. Mechanic looked and advised to get a thermostat and new O-ring. I wondered if anyone could tell me how to find the thermostat on my car and how to replace it myself if possible in detail?
